Lightweight Qualities of Aluminum Alloys
Aluminum alloys are renowned for their lightweight residential properties, making them a favored choice in different industries, consisting of aerospace and vehicle. The thickness of aluminum is about one-third that of steel, permitting considerable weight reductions without endangering structural stability. This feature allows suppliers to generate parts that boost gas effectiveness and total efficiency in vehicles and airplane.
In addition, making use of aluminum alloys adds to decrease transportation expenses due to reduced weight, which is particularly helpful in shipping and logistics. Engineers and designers take advantage of these products to develop intricate forms and styles that would be impractical with heavier steels. The capacity to combine light-weight attributes with toughness and toughness makes aluminum alloys an optimal choice for applications requiring extensive efficiency standards. Overall, the lightweight nature of aluminum alloys places them as a crucial product ahead of time modern technology and enhancing sustainability across different sectors.
Outstanding Deterioration Resistance
When subjected to rough settings, products typically catch degradation; however, light weight aluminum alloys exhibit phenomenal deterioration resistance that establishes them apart. This remarkable residential property comes from a natural oxide layer that bases on the surface of aluminum, supplying a safety barrier against dampness, salt, and various other destructive representatives. Unlike several metals, light weight aluminum does not rust, that makes it an ideal selection for applications in marine, automobile, and building and construction sectors.
In addition, aluminum alloys can be treated with numerous finishes and surfaces to boost their corrosion resistance even more. These therapies guarantee durability and longevity, decreasing maintenance expenses in time. The capability to withstand corrosive problems without considerable deterioration enables makers to count on light weight aluminum elements for prolonged periods, ultimately leading to better operational performance. The extraordinary deterioration resistance of aluminum alloys places them as an exceptional option for high-quality steel casting options in varied environments.

Eco-Friendly and Recyclable Product
Aluminum foundries are progressively acknowledging the value of eco-friendly and recyclable materials in their manufacturing procedures. Aluminum itself is one of the most recyclable metals, with the ability to be recycled forever without losing its residential or commercial properties. This characteristic greatly decreases the ecological impact linked with steel casting, as recycled light weight aluminum requires only a portion of the power required to generate brand-new aluminum from bauxite ore.
Utilizing recycled aluminum not just lessens waste however additionally preserves natural deposits and lowers greenhouse gas emissions. As industries change towards lasting methods, light weight aluminum foundries are adopting more eco-conscious approaches, such as using energy-efficient modern technologies and lowering unsafe exhausts throughout manufacturing.

What Kinds Of Aluminum Alloys Are Generally Made Use Of in Factory Processes?
Commonly used light weight aluminum alloys in shop processes consist of A356, A380, and A413 (Aluminum Foundry). These alloys are preferred for their outstanding castability, mechanical homes, and deterioration resistance, making them ideal for various commercial applications and components

How Does the Recycling Process for Aluminum Job?
The reusing process for aluminum includes gathering scrap, shredding it, thawing it down, and removing pollutants. This recycled aluminum can after that be cast right into brand-new products, significantly reducing power consumption and ecological impact compared to primary manufacturing.
